Your browser is not supported. Please use a newer browser for the full MHR experience.

Rink

Messa Rink at Achilles Center

Schenectady, NY

AKA

  • Union College Ice Arena

Address

Alexander Lane Schenectady, NY 12308

Phone

518-388-6134

Home Ice Of